ADVERTISEMENT FOR BIDS
WALDEN POND DREDGE PROJECT
IFB# 2026-037
Pursuant to North Carolina General Statutes (NCGS) 143-128 and 143-129, sealed Bids for the
construction of the WALDEN POND DREDGE PROJECT will be received by the Union County
Procurement Department until 2:00 PM on Tuesday, November 25, 2025, at the Union County
Procurement Department, 610 Patton Avenue, Monroe, NC 28110 at which time the Bids will be
publicly opened and read aloud. Late bids will not be accepted.
If a Bid is sent by mail or other delivery system, the sealed envelope containing the Bid shall be
enclosed in a separate package plainly marked on the outside with the notation “BID ENCLOSED
– 2026-037” and shall be addressed to Union County Procurement Department, Attn: Vicky Watts,
610 Patton Avenue, Monroe, NC 28110.
The Project consists of constructing the following:
1. Dredging of approximately 7000 CY of accumulated sediment from Walden Pond.
2. Miscellaneous civil/site work including storm drain piping, grading, erosion control,
paving and other miscellaneous work;
3. Miscellaneous restoration activities.
Bids will be received for a single prime Contract. Bids shall be on a unit price basis as indicated
in the Bidding Documents. Bidders are hereby notified that they must be properly licensed as
required by Chapter 87 of the North Carolina General Statutes.

Bidders are required to provide a non-collusion affidavit, as set forth in the bidding documents. As
provided by statute, a deposit of cash, cashier’s check or certified check on some bank or trust
company insured by the Federal Deposit insurance Company, or a bid bond executed by corporate
surety licensed under the laws of North Carolina to execute such bonds in the amount of 5% of the
bid must accompany each bid. The payee shall be “Union County”. Said deposit shall guarantee
that the Agreement will be entered into by the successful bidder if award is made. Such deposit
may be held by Union County until the successful bidder has executed and delivered all required
Contract documents to Union County.
Union County reserves the right to reject any or all bids, including without limitation,
nonconforming, nonresponsive, unbalanced, or conditional Bids. Owner further reserves the right
to reject the Bid and Bidder whom they find, after reasonable inquiry and evaluation, to not be
responsible. Owner may also reject the Bid and Bidder if the Owner believes that it would not be
in the best interest of the Project to make an award to that Bidder. Owner also reserves the right to
waive all informalities and technicalities not involving price, time, or changes in the Work and to
negotiate, as allowed by law, contract terms with the Successful Bidder.
